Red Sox star hits towering home run in Team USA debut
By Mac Cerullo
Published on March 3, 2026.
Red Sox outfielder Roman Anthony hit a two-run home run during Team USA's first exhibition against the San Francisco Giants in Scottsdale, Arizona. The home run came with no out of play and was delivered with a 93.8 mph fastball from Blade Tidwell. The U.S. team went on to win 15-1.
Read Original Article